DVD Review

Be Cool, like its predecessor Get Shorty, was adapted by Elmore Leonard from his own novel, while Quentin Tarantino also sourced a Leonard book (Rum Punch) for Jackie Brown. Get the picture? The guy can write!

John Travolta reprises his original role as Chili Palmer, the hoodlum-turned-entertainment entrepreneur. This time he's taking on the music biz, adopting and an aspiring young singer (Christina Milian) and sparring with idiot wannabe Vince Vaughn.

High points include performances by the gorgeous Milian and former wrestler The Rock camping it up, while dragooning Uma Thurman into dancing with Travolta, as if some of Pulp Fiction's fairydust will fall on them as a result, is surely a low.

Extras include: behind the scenes with F. Gary Gray; gag reel; deleted scenes; Close-Up featurettes on The Rock, André 3000 and Christina Milian plus the music video for The Rock as Elliot Wilhelm singing You Ain't Woman Enough To Take My Man.
